一、香港双活架构设计核心原则
香港服务器双活架构设计需要遵循几个关键原则:是业务连续性原则,确保在任何单一数据中心故障时,业务能够无缝切换;是数据一致性原则,采用可靠的数据同步机制保证两地数据实时一致;第三是性能优化原则,通过合理的网络架构设计降低跨数据中心访问延迟。香港特有的地理位置和网络环境要求我们在设计时充分考虑海底光缆的冗余路径,以及与中国大陆和海外网络连接的优化。同时需要遵守香港个人资料隐私条例等本地法规要求,在数据存储和传输方面做好合规设计。
二、关键技术实现方案
在香港实施服务器双活架构,需要重点考虑以下技术组件:存储层可采用基于SAN的同步复制技术或分布式存储系统,确保数据实时同步;计算层需要部署集群管理软件实现应用自动故障转移;网络层建议使用BGP Anycast技术实现流量智能调度。针对香港国际网络环境特点,特别推荐采用SD-WAN技术优化跨数据中心网络质量,通过多条运营商线路的负载均衡和智能选路,有效解决香港与海外网络互联的延迟问题。数据库层面,Oracle RAC、MySQL Cluster或MongoDB分片集群都是可行的技术选择,需根据业务特点进行选型。
对于存储同步,香港双活架构通常采用两种模式:同步镜像和异步复制。同步镜像能保证数据零丢失,但对网络延迟敏感,适合金融交易类应用;异步复制对网络要求较低,适合大容量数据场景。建议在香港本地两个数据中心间采用同步镜像,而与海外数据中心间采用异步复制。EMC SRDF、IBM Metro Mirror和NetApp SnapMirror都是经过验证的企业级解决方案。
香港双活架构的网络设计需要特别注意:确保两个数据中心间有多条独立物理路径,建议至少使用两家不同运营商的专线;要优化路由策略,减少跨数据中心通信的跳数;第三要部署足够的带宽容量,通常建议预留日常峰值流量的200%作为缓冲。针对DDoS防护,可以在两个数据中心同时部署清洗设备,形成协同防御体系。
三、实施步骤与运维管理
香港服务器双活架构的实施应分阶段进行:第一阶段进行现状评估和需求分析,确定RPO和RTO目标;第二阶段设计详细技术方案,包括硬件选型和网络拓扑;第三阶段搭建测试环境进行验证;第四阶段逐步迁移生产负载。运维管理方面,需要建立统一的监控平台,实时跟踪两地资源状态和数据同步情况。定期进行故障切换演练至关重要,建议每季度至少进行一次全流程演练,检验系统的实际容灾能力。同时要制定详细的应急预案,明确各种故障场景下的处置流程和责任人。